Wondering if the Clare View House can sleep 4 people, 5 people, 6 people, 7 people or 8 people? We can accommodate up to 8 adults in 3 bedrooms of which 2 have a Queen size bed and 1 has 2 Double beds. We are the perfect place to stay for two couples with both 2 kids. The parents get their own bedroom and the kids share the 1 bedroom with the 2 double beds. We also get a lot of bookings with 2 or 3 couples and whole families with grandparents, parents and grandkids. The video above gives you a good idea of the million dollar views at Clare View. The property overlooks water dams, paddocks, trees, vineyards and in a distance the ridges of the Clare Valley and further (45 km away) the Hummock Range near Snowtown and even further away (65 km) the distant peaks of the North Mount Lofty Ranges. Both of them have windfarms on them. Also visible are the two hills in Neagles Rock conservation Park. Clare View got 6 alpacas in November 2010 and a baby alpaca was born in April 2011. The funny looking herd chews it's way around the paddocks around the B&B.
Just a video of a happy kangaroo in Clare, filmed at Clare View. Kangaroos are very often seen at our property. We quite often have a group of 4 to 8 kangeroos around the place.
